Overview
HCF4511BEY from STMicroelectronics is a BCD-to-7-segment latch/decoder/driver IC with CMOS input logic and bipolar NPN output transistors, designed to directly drive common-cathode LED displays. It features 4-bit BCD inputs (A–D), active-low Blanking (BL) and Lamp Test (LT) controls, Latch Enable/Strobe (LE), 7-segment outputs (a–g), ±25mA sourcing capability per segment, and operation across 3V to 20V supply range.
For engineers reviewing the HCF4511BEY datasheet, HCF4511BEY pinout, HCF4511BEY application, or HCF4511BEY equivalent, key selection considerations include its direct LED-driving capability, latch functionality for static display hold, blanking control for multiplexed systems, and compatibility with legacy 4500-series CMOS timing and logic families.
Technical Context
The HCF4511BEY integrates dual-technology architecture: high-noise-immunity CMOS logic for BCD decoding and latching, paired with saturated NPN bipolar output transistors capable of sourcing up to 25mA per segment. Its internal logic decodes valid BCD codes (0000–1001) into active-high 7-segment drive signals while blanking outputs for invalid codes (1010–1111).
Three dedicated control inputs-Latch Enable/Strobe (pin 5), Blanking (pin 4), and Lamp Test (pin 3)-enable real-time display management: LE captures and holds BCD input, BL forces all outputs low (blanking), and LT overrides decoding to force all segments high (full test illumination). Propagation delays range from 50ns (LT input) to 1320ns (data path) at VDD = 5V.

Pinout & Package
HCF4511BEY is supplied in a 16-pin plastic DIP package (0.3-inch width), with lead finish compatible with standard through-hole reflow and wave soldering processes.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1, 2, 6, 7 | BCD Inputs A–D | Active-high binary-coded decimal inputs; latched on rising edge of LE when BL = H and LT = H |
| 3 | Lamp Test (LT) | Active-low input forcing all segment outputs high - used for full-display verification independent of BCD code |
| 4 | Blanking (BL) | Active-low input forcing all segment outputs low - enables display blanking during multiplexing or power-save modes |
| 5 | Latch Enable / Strobe (LE) | Active-high latch control; captures and holds current BCD input on rising edge - essential for static display hold |
| 8 | VSS | Negative supply terminal (GND); reference for all logic and output stages |
| 9–15 | Segment Outputs a–g | Active-high outputs driving common-cathode displays; each capable of sourcing ≥25mA |
| 16 | VDD | Positive supply terminal; supports 3V–20V operation with full parameter compliance |

FAQ
What is the maximum supply voltage for reliable operation of HCF4511BEY?
HCF4511BEY is rated for continuous operation up to 20V VDD, with absolute maximum rating of +22V. All DC electrical specifications-including output drive, quiescent current, and noise margin-are guaranteed across 3V to 20V at temperatures from –55°C to +125°C. Operation above 20V voids specification compliance and risks permanent damage.
Can HCF4511BEY drive common-anode LED displays?
No. HCF4511BEY provides active-high, sourcing outputs designed exclusively for common-cathode 7-segment displays. Its outputs cannot sink current; attempting to connect to common-anode configurations will result in no illumination or potential latch-up. For common-anode use, a complementary device such as the HCF4543B (with active-low sinking outputs) is required.
How does the Latch Enable (LE) input behave during Blanking (BL) or Lamp Test (LT)?
When BL = L (active), all segment outputs are forced low regardless of LE state or BCD input - latching is effectively disabled. When LT = L, all outputs go high irrespective of LE or BL - latching is also overridden. Latching only occurs when both BL = H and LT = H, and a rising edge is applied to LE. This priority hierarchy ensures predictable display control during diagnostics or power-down.
